Capacity Challenges in Idaho's Agricultural Workforce
Idaho's agricultural sector is facing significant workforce challenges, primarily due to a lack of skilled labor. As one of the leading states in food production, with agriculture accounting for 13% of the state's economy, addressing this barrier is vital. According to recent reports, Idaho farms employ around 20% of the state’s workforce, yet many positions remain unfilled due to insufficient training and educational opportunities.
Who Should Apply for Idaho Grants
Grants are available for nonprofits in Idaho that focus on agricultural training programs targeting underserved youth. Organizations that aim to equip young participants with essential farming and agricultural skills are encouraged to apply. Eligible entities include tax-exempt organizations under Section 501(c)(3) that have a proven track record of facilitating job training and educational programs in agriculture.
Application Requirements and Realities
Applicants must clearly articulate how their programs provide training and educational opportunities in agriculture. This includes detailing hands-on experiences, internships, or mentorships that will engage youth in real-world agricultural practices. Applicants must also provide evidence of community support and outline how their programs align with local agricultural needs. Realistic timelines and measurable outcomes must accompany proposals to demonstrate anticipated short- and long-term impacts on youth employment in the sector.
Capacity Gaps in Idaho's Infrastructure
In Idaho, the gap in agricultural workforce training is compounded by limitations in educational infrastructure, particularly in rural areas. Many potential trainees lack access to basic resources and facilities needed for effective agricultural training. Additionally, workforce development resources are often limited, leading to insufficient exposure for youth to career pathways in agriculture. Therefore, initiatives that aim to develop training programs must address these infrastructure challenges head-on.
Readiness Requirements for Effective Implementation
To prepare for potential funding, nonprofit organizations must evaluate their capacity to implement agricultural training programs effectively. This includes identifying community partnerships that can provide necessary resources and expertise, as well as understanding local agricultural trends and employer needs. Programs should be designed to instill practical skills and knowledge relevant to Idaho's agricultural landscape, fostering a stronger future workforce ready to meet the industry’s demands.
